The banner read, "Some say the Tigers can't go with the best. We'll prove them wrong as today we win this test". It didn't mention the 'f' word, but on that performance, it should have. Of course, the Tigers have to make it to the finals first, but the way they dismantled Hawthorn showed they are capable of shaking up September. They simply smashed the Hawks around the clearances. In fact, at one point they led that stat 13-0. Trent Cotchin led the midfield like a man possessed. In defence, Alex Rance and Troy Chaplin stopped Lance Franklin and Jarryd Roughead. Up forward, Jack Riewoldt was up and about. The Tiger army can just about taste it. The lid is inches away from being off. It's music to Chris Newman's ears. He's played 231 games without a final, but this year, the drought could well be over. Is it Tigertime?
